> BTW be careful about the words you use : internal repository is not
> the same as a local repository. A local repository should be only
> local to a developer desktop and not on a network drives or you will
> have speed issues.

Ok, understand.

In case of using an internal repository - what is the analog to mvn install?

For instance I want to share a third party artifact and do something like
mvn     install:install-file    -Dfile=./jta-1.0.1B.jar 
-DgroupId=javax.transaction
-DartifactId=jta -Dversion=1.0.1B       -Dpackaging=jar

This installs an artifact into the local repo. How do I install an artifact into
an internal repo?
